AI Technical Summary
In the processing of high-deformation-resistant cardboard, existing cutting equipment suffers from rapid blade wear, requiring periodic shutdowns for disassembly and grinding, which is cumbersome and affects production efficiency.
Design a high-deformation-resistant cardboard processing device that utilizes a combination of conveyor belt, cutting blade, grinding unit and control components to achieve automatic grinding without stopping the machine or disassembling the blade. The cutting blade is continuously ground by conveying and discharging waste edges of the cardboard.
This technology enables continuous grinding of cutting tools without stopping the machine or disassembling the tool, improving production efficiency and reducing operational complexity and time costs.
